- Background: This study aims to develop habitat radiomic models to predict overall survival for hepatocellular carcinoma , based on the characterization of the intratumoral heterogeneity reflected in F-FDG PET/CT images. Methods: A total of 137 HCC patients from two institutions were retrospectively included.
